排序
如何用JavaScript監(jiān)聽按鈕點擊事件?
使用javascript監(jiān)聽按鈕點擊事件的最常見方法是addeventlistener。1)獲取按鈕元素;2)使用addeventlistener方法添加點擊事件監(jiān)聽器;3)考慮事件冒泡和捕獲的影響;4)利用事件委托優(yōu)化性能;...
網(wǎng)頁代碼編輯器如何實現(xiàn)代碼輸入?
在線代碼編輯器的html元素解析:一個常見的誤區(qū) 許多在線代碼編輯器支持HTML、CSS和JavaScript代碼輸入。 最近,一位用戶發(fā)現(xiàn)難以識別特定網(wǎng)頁代碼編輯器中用于代碼輸入的HTML元素。 盡管頁面顯...
為什么我的<a>標(biāo)簽點擊圖片后下載而非預(yù)覽?
關(guān)于<a>標(biāo)簽點擊下載圖片而非預(yù)覽的問題 在網(wǎng)頁開發(fā)中,我們常使用<a>標(biāo)簽鏈接各種資源,包括圖片。但有時點擊指向同源圖片的<a>標(biāo)簽,瀏覽器會下載圖片,而非在當(dāng)前頁面或新標(biāo)簽頁預(yù)覽,...
JavaScript中的class靜態(tài)方法怎么用?
javascript中的class靜態(tài)方法通過static關(guān)鍵字定義,直接綁定到類上,通過類名調(diào)用。使用場景包括:1.類級別的工具方法,如數(shù)學(xué)運(yùn)算;2.工廠方法,用于創(chuàng)建實例;3.類級別的配置管理。使用時需...
如何用JavaScript配置TypeScript?
用javascript配置typescript可以通過編寫tsconfig.json文件實現(xiàn)。1. 使用node.js的fs模塊將javascript對象轉(zhuǎn)換為json格式并寫入tsconfig.json文件。2. 可以根據(jù)環(huán)境變量動態(tài)調(diào)整配置選項。3. 需...
如何安全地從函數(shù)內(nèi)部獲取并更新外部變量?
函數(shù)內(nèi)外變量訪問與更新的最佳實踐 在程序開發(fā)中,安全地訪問和更新函數(shù)內(nèi)部變量至關(guān)重要。本文探討如何避免直接訪問函數(shù)內(nèi)部變量,并提供一種更安全、更優(yōu)雅的解決方案,以解決在add_month()函...
如何調(diào)試網(wǎng)頁中消失的日歷彈框自定義樣式?
網(wǎng)頁日歷彈框樣式調(diào)試技巧 網(wǎng)頁開發(fā)中,修改日歷彈框樣式時,直接操作DOM元素可能導(dǎo)致彈框消失。本文提供一種調(diào)試方法,即使彈框在開發(fā)者工具打開后消失,也能有效修改其樣式。 問題: 點擊日歷...
當(dāng)在Chrome中使用Promise.allSettled時,低版本Firefox不支持,如何兼容?
在chrome中使用promise.allsettled時,可以通過polyfill兼容低版本firefox。具體方法是:1)檢查promise對象是否包含allsettled方法,若無則實現(xiàn)polyfill;2)使用promise.all處理轉(zhuǎn)換后的promise...
如何利用CSS的繼承性來簡化代碼?
css繼承性可以簡化代碼并提高可維護(hù)性和一致性。1) 設(shè)置全局樣式如字體和顏色,可以減少重復(fù)代碼并確保一致性。2) 注意某些屬性不繼承,需單獨設(shè)置。3) 使用更具體的選擇器避免默認(rèn)樣式覆蓋。4)...
在Nginx中如何配置指向React項目中帶有哈希值的index.html文件?
Nginx配置:處理React項目中帶有哈希值的index.html文件 React應(yīng)用打包后,index.html文件名通常會包含哈希值,例如index.a1b2c3d4.html。本文介紹如何在Nginx中正確配置,以處理這些帶有哈希值...
如何讓頁面中的滑動組件在不同屏幕尺寸下都能流暢運(yùn)行?
滑動組件在不同屏幕尺寸下保持流暢運(yùn)行可以通過以下步驟實現(xiàn):1. 使用css的transform屬性和overflow-x:auto實現(xiàn)基本滑動效果。2. 利用javascript處理觸摸事件,計算滑動距離和速度,確保平滑過...